发明名称 ZIRCONIA-BASED CERAMIC MATERIAL
摘要 PROBLEM TO BE SOLVED: To provide zirconia-based ceramics which are thermally stable, inexpensive and have high strength. SOLUTION: The ceramics have the composition consisting of 70 to 99.95 vol.% of substantial zirconium oxide containing MgO as a stabilizer or containing MgO as the essential component and at least one kind of oxide of Ca, Ti and rare earth elements by 5 to 15 mol% in total, 0.05 to 30 vol.% of at least one kind of SiC, TiC, MoC, WC, ZrC, HfC, MgAl2O4, ZnO and NiO, and <=3 vol.% of other impurities. The ceramics are manufactured by normal pressure sintering and hot isotropic pressurizing process. In the X-ray diffraction analysis using the Cu-K&alpha; line for the surface of the ceramics after cutting, grinding and polishing into a mirror surface, the proportion (Vm) of the monoclinic phase calculated from the intensity of diffraction lines (Im, It) on the (-111) and (111) planes of the monoclinic crystal and on the (111) plane of the tetragonal crystal according to the formulae, Xm= Im(-111)+Im(111)}/ Im(-111)+Im(111)+It(111)} and Vm=1.311Xm/(1+0.311Xm)&times;100 ranges 4 to 40 vol.%.
